Laura Gatien is the founder, CEO, and clinical therapist at Laura Gatien & Associates. She has extensive experience working with individuals and couples facing challenges such as anxiety, depression, burnout, parenting issues, sexual health, self-esteem, domestic violence, family dynamics, and chronic illnesses. She utilizes various counseling frameworks and techniques, including attachment theory, interpersonal therapy, and narrative therapy. Laura Gatien & Associates provides confidential mental health counselling to adults, teens, children, and couples. The clinic offers services including individual counselling, eye movement des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R) therapy, play therapy, and gender-affirming care. The clinic offers appointments with no wait time.

Cynthia Veniot is a Licensed Counselling Therapist and the founder of Kingsway Counselling. She offers therapeutic relief to individuals grappling with a wide range of mental health challenges. She specializes in Child Therapy (age 5+), for adolescents, and adults experiencing anxiety, depression, life transitions, and relationship issues. Cynthia Veniot is fluent in French and English. Her practice also provides Trauma Therapy, Couples Therapy, and Child Therapy to individuals, families, and children of all ages. They offer customized treatment through assessing mental health concerns, gathering details regarding background and history, and developing a treatment plan.

Lora Durant ear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Psychology and a Master of Education in Counselling Psychology from The University of New Brunswick. She is a Licensed Counselling Therapist Candidate with the College of Counselling Therapists of New Brunswick and a Canadian Certified Counsellor with the Canadian Counselling and Psychotherapy Association. With more than two decades of experience, she specializes in working with at-risk youth, their families, and individuals dealing with trauma. Lora Durant works with children, teens, individuals, and couples using an integrated and client-centered approach. Her areas of expertise include depression, stress and anxiety management, anger management, parenting issues, behavioural issues, and trauma. Lora Durant practices at Gentle Path Counselling Services. The clinic offers professional counselling and educational group programs.
